Astra

License: GPL v3 Python 3.11 uv Tests Docs

Astra (Automated Survey observaTory Robotised with Alpaca) is an open-source observatory control software for automating and managing robotic observatories. It integrates seamlessly with ASCOM Alpaca for hardware control.

Astra themed art


Features

  • Fully Robotic — Schedule once, observe automatically with error and bad weather handling
  • ASCOM Alpaca — Compatible with your existing ASCOM equipment
  • Cross-Platform — Python based, runs on Windows, Linux, macOS
  • Moving Targets — Non-sidereal tracking of planets, comets, asteroids, and satellites from TLEs
  • Web Interface — Manage your observatory from any browser, use cloudflared or similar to access outside your network
  • Comprehensive Docs — Setup, usage, and module reference
